[rabbitmq-discuss] Starting Persister stage takes a long time

Ben Hood 0x6e6562 at gmail.com
Thu Sep 11 11:54:23 BST 2008


On Thu, Sep 11, 2008 at 7:20 AM, Eran Sandler <eran.sandler at gmail.com> wrote:
> I've been using erlsrv to run rabbitmq. At some point when I started to get
> the 541 error I previously reported upon I decided to restart the service.
> It seems to get stuck and not respond so I run the command line and saw that
> its stuck on the starting persister stage and uses a lot of CPU.

Bear in mind that whilst erlsrv is known to work for a few people from
the community, this is not something that we have tested nor support

When you say that it is stuck, for how long does it stick in the
persister stage?

Also, how big is the log file?

Again, if you send some code that reproduces your usage so that we can
run it, stop the broker and restart so that we can reproduce your

> Is it because I simply stopped the service instead of using rabbitmqctl stop
> ? What is the proper way of stopping rabbitmq?

No, that's a perfectly fine way of stopping the broker.


